Abstract

A semiconductor structure including at least one spare cell is disclosed. The semiconductor structure includes a first conductive line coupled to a power supply, and a second conductive line coupled to a complementary power supply. At least one spare cell is decoupled from the first or second conductive line for being selectively connected to at least one normally functioning electronic components, the first conductive line and the second conductive line only during a rerouting process for reducing leakage power of the semiconductor structure.
